- Database Connectivity: Establishing reliable and efficient connections to various database systems is paramount. OSCPOST should support a wide range of database platforms, including Oracle, SQL Server, MySQL, and PostgreSQL, with optimized drivers for each.
- Data Transformation: Transforming data from different formats and structures into a consistent format is crucial for accurate analysis. OSCPOST should provide robust data transformation capabilities, including data type conversion, data cleansing, and data enrichment.
- Security: Protecting sensitive financial data is of utmost importance. OSCPOST should offer strong security features, such as encryption, access control, and auditing, to safeguard data during transit and at rest.
- Performance: Optimizing performance is essential for handling large volumes of financial data. OSCPOST should be designed for scalability and performance, with features such as data compression, parallel processing, and caching.
- Optimize Database Queries: Craft efficient SQL queries that retrieve only the necessary data. Avoid using
SELECT *and instead specify the required columns. Utilize indexes to speed up data retrieval. - Implement Data Caching: Cache frequently accessed data to reduce the load on the database servers. OSCPOST should provide caching mechanisms to store data in memory or on disk for faster access.
- Use Parallel Processing: Divide large data processing tasks into smaller chunks that can be processed in parallel. OSCPOST should support parallel processing to leverage multi-core processors and distributed computing environments.
- Compress Data: Compress data during transit and storage to reduce bandwidth consumption and storage space. OSCPOST should offer data compression capabilities to minimize data transfer times and storage costs.
- Implement Data Validation: Validate data at the source and during transformation to prevent errors and inconsistencies. OSCPOST should provide data validation rules and error handling mechanisms.
- Use Data Reconciliation: Reconcile data between the source and target databases to ensure that all data has been transferred correctly. OSCPOST should offer data reconciliation tools to compare data sets and identify discrepancies.
- Maintain Data Lineage: Track the origin and transformation history of data to understand its provenance and ensure accountability. OSCPOST should provide data lineage tracking capabilities to trace data back to its source.
- Implement Data Governance: Establish data governance policies and procedures to ensure data quality, consistency, and compliance with regulatory requirements.
- Implement Encryption: Encrypt data at rest and in transit to protect it from unauthorized access. OSCPOST should support encryption algorithms such as AES and SSL/TLS.
- Use Access Control: Restrict access to sensitive data based on user roles and permissions. OSCPOST should provide granular access control mechanisms to limit data visibility and modification.
- Implement Auditing: Audit all data access and modification activities to detect and prevent security breaches. OSCPOST should provide auditing capabilities to track user activity and data changes.
- Comply with Regulations: Ensure compliance with relevant data privacy regulations, such as GDPR and CCPA. OSCPOST should provide features to help organizations comply with these regulations.

Understanding Cross-Database Finance
Cross-database finance involves managing financial data that resides in multiple, often heterogeneous, database systems. This scenario arises frequently in large organizations with diverse business units, legacy systems, or those undergoing mergers and acquisitions. The challenge lies in consolidating, harmonizing, and analyzing data from these disparate sources to gain a unified financial perspective. Effective cross-database finance requires robust tools and strategies to overcome compatibility issues, data inconsistencies, and security concerns.
